BBF-05001 |
L-Tryptophyl-L-glutamine (175027-12-0) Inquiry |
|
L-Tryptophyl-L-glutamine is a dipeptide consisting of tryptophan (L-Trp) and glutamine (L-Gln). Tryptophan is an aromatic, hydrophobic amino acid known for its role in protein structure and as a precursor for serotonin and melatonin. Glutamine, a polar amino acid, is crucial for nitrogen metabolism and cellular functions. This dipeptide can be used in studies related to protein interactions, structural analysis, or in the design of peptides with potential therapeutic applications. The combination of tryptophan and glutamine may also influence the peptide's properties and its interaction with biological systems. |

BBF-05002 |
Torreyanic acid (176260-42-7) Inquiry |
|
Torreyanic acid is a dimer quinone obtained from the endophytic bacterium Pestalotiopsis microspora. Torreyanic acid is cytotoxic to tumor cells and is 5-10 times more effective in cell lines sensitive to protein kinase C agonists. |
